Beyond Static Images: Dynamic Posture Analysis in Action

Traditional posture analysis often hinges on static images, capturing a single moment in time. This limited snapshot can't fully reveal the nuances of human movement and postural variation. Dynamic posture analysis, however, takes a posture assessment software different approach by tracking movement over time. Utilizing sensors and advanced algorithms, this technique provides a more comprehensive understanding of how our bodies adjust throughout the day. By analyzing these dynamic trends, we can pinpoint subtle postural imbalances that may not be apparent in static images.
